2024 State Reporting Updates

Share

Thursday, November 14, 2024 | 2:00PM - 3:45PM Eastern Time

As federal regulations governing 1099 reporting continue to evolve, you can often expect to see corresponding changes in direct state reporting regulations. It's imperative for businesses to remain informed about state reporting updates in all states where they conduct business to avoid audits, fines and other penalties. Key areas of focus include alterations to reporting thresholds and deadlines, updates to filing methods, modifications in participation within the Combined Federal State Filing (CF/SF) program, and any new Direct State Reporting obligations. Additionally, staying current with these state-level system modernizations is essential to ensure compliance in the upcoming reporting year. This session will include a review of 1099 state reporting, key updates impacting the upcoming reporting season and best practices for a successful season.
